Top Areas for Property Investment in Medellín
Medellín, Colombia's vibrant second city, is quickly becoming a global hotspot for property investors. With its thriving economy, affordable cost of living and stunning scenery, it's no wonder that many are flocking to this dynamic metropolis. Among the numerous neighborhoods offering lucrative opportunities, certain areas stand out as particularly promising.
El Poblado, renowned for its upscale boutiques, restaurants and nightlife, continues to attract both locals and expats seeking a sophisticated lifestyle. This affluent district boasts a robust property market with high rental yields and considerable capital appreciation potential.
On the other hand, Laureles offers a more tranquil atmosphere, making it an attractive option for families and those seeking a slower pace of life. This charming neighborhood is characterized by its tree-lined streets, quaint cafes and vibrant community spirit. Despite being less expensive than El Poblado, Laureles still offers good return on investment.
If you're looking for a more central location, the districts of Provenza and Casco Antiguo are worth considering. These areas offer easy access to Medellín's main attractions and amenities, making them ideal for both residents and tourists.
